The Registrar’s Office oversees student records, class scheduling, and policies as they pertain to the student academic experience.
Students use URSA (University Records and Systems Assistant) to register for classes and manage their own personal data, and it is the job of the Registrar's Office to protect that information and validate it for future employers or for other educational institutions.
Students use URSA to…
- Schedule for classes
- Manage personal data
- Check grades
- Apply for graduation
Faculty members use URSA to…
- Share course syllabi
- Post office hours
- Enter grades
- Find class and advisee listings
Students and alumni may order transcripts through the Registrar’s Office, which also sets the academic calendar and the class schedule and publishes the Undergraduate Catalog. The catalog specifies requirements students need to earn a degree and all the policies associated with academics.
